Andora Company reported the following information for the month of November. The standard cost of labor for the month was $38,300, but actual wages paid were $40,100. Andora has calculated its direct labor rate and efficiency variances to be $540 favorable and $2.340 unfavorable, respectively. Prepare the necessary journal entry to record Andora's direct labor cost for the month, assuming that standard labor costs are recorded directly to Cost of Good Sold.
